导读:
MySQL是一种关系型数据库管理系统,它提供了许多函数来处理文本和字符串。求字节函数是其中一种常用的函数,它可以帮助我们计算字符串中包含的字节数量。这篇文章将介绍MySQL中的求字节函数及其使用方法。
1. CHAR_LENGTH函数
CHAR_LENGTH函数返回指定字符串的字符数,其中一个多字节字符被计算为一个字符。例如,对于“你好”,CHAR_LENGTH函数将返回2。
语法:CHAR_LENGTH(str)
示例:
SELECT CHAR_LENGTH('你好');
结果:2
2. LENGTH函数
LENGTH函数返回指定字符串的字节数,其中一个多字节字符被计算为多个字节。例如,对于“你好”,LENGTH函数将返回6。
语法:LENGTH(str)
SELECT LENGTH('你好');
结果:6
3. OCTET_LENGTH函数
OCTET_LENGTH函数返回指定字符串的字节数,其中一个多字节字符被计算为一个字节。例如,对于“你好”,OCTET_LENGTH函数将返回4。
语法:OCTET_LENGTH(str)
SELECT OCTET_LENGTH('你好');
结果:4
总结:
通过使用MySQL中的求字节函数,我们可以方便地计算字符串中包含的字节数量。根据需要,我们可以选择使用CHAR_LENGTH、LENGTH或OCTET_LENGTH函数来满足我们的需求。